Unleash Your Confidence: A Guide to Open Cup Bras
Looking to add a little spice to your lingerie collection? An open cup bra, also known as a shelf bra, might be just what you're searching for. This unique style is designed to enhance your natural shape while leaving the upper part of your breasts exposed. It's a bold and alluring choice, perfect for special occasions or simply when you want to feel extra confident.
But what exactly is an open cup bra, and who is it for? Simply put, it's a bra that doesn't fully cover the breasts. Key Features and Benefits
- Enhanced Shape: Open cup bras provide lift and support, creating a fuller, more rounded appearance.
- Alluring Design: The exposed upper breast adds a touch of sensuality and confidence.
- Versatile Style: Available in various materials, colors, and embellishments to suit your personal taste.
- Comfortable Support: Despite the revealing design, open cup bras still offer comfortable support for everyday wear or special occasions.

Buying Advice and Practical Considerations
When shopping for an open cup bra, consider the following:
- Size: Ensure you get the correct band and cup size for a comfortable and supportive fit.
- Material: Choose a material that feels good against your skin, such as lace, satin, or microfiber.
- Style: Select a style that complements your body type and desired level of coverage.
- Support: Consider the level of support you need, especially if you have a larger bust.
